Flying from Newquay Cornwall Airport (NQY) to Malaga Airport (AGP): what you need to know
Around 2 hours 30 minutes is how long you'll be travelling on a direct flight from Newquay Cornwall Airport to Malaga Airport.
Málaga's timezone is UTC+1, making Málaga one hour ahead of Newquay.

Handy information about Newquay Cornwall Airport (NQY)
64.34% of flights taking off from Newquay Cornwall Airport touch down at their destination on time.
Newquay Cornwall Airport is about 6 miles from central Newquay. If you're driving, catching a cab or ride-sharing from the centre, it'll take 15 minutes or so to get there, depending on the traffic.
You can expect a journey time of roughly 35 minutes on public transport.

Getting from Malaga Airport (AGP) to central Málaga
From Malaga Airport, Málaga is approximately 9 miles away. It takes around 25 minutes to get to the centre driving.
It'll take around 50 minutes if you're travelling by public transport.
When to fly to Malaga Airport (AGP)
It's time to plan your travel dates for your flight from Newquay Cornwall Airport to Malaga Airport. July is the busiest month to head to Málaga. If you prefer a quieter vibe, go in January.
The warmest month in Málaga is July, with temperatures ranging between 21ºC (70ºF) and 34ºC (93ºF). Book your flights from Newquay Cornwall Airport to Malaga Airport in this month if this is the type of weather you enjoy.
If you'd rather trav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from NQY to AGP in January. Temperatures average between 7ºC (45ºF) and 17ºC (63ºF) then.
